I am sorry but this game is not a "XSX masterpiece" as they put it here (meaning masterpiece only on XSX / XSS). Let me explain:
According to John XSX (1600p-4k 60fps) gives you basically the X1X (1600p-4k 30fps) game at double framerate.
So there is actually no improvement from newer RDNA2 technology, only linear improvement 1x from GCN to RDNA2. XSX is equivalent to 12 GCN Tflops.
I say it's disappointing because when we look at for instance Death Stranding on PS5 (exclusive console / PC, like FH5), the game on PS5 at native 4K 60fps (10.2tf) pushes 4x more stuff than Pro 4K CBR 30fps (4.2tf), for about the same performance according to the analysis that was done in the NXGamer thread. So PS5 would be the equivalent of 16.8 GCN tflops. There is a 1.6x improvement from GCN Tflops to PS5 RDNA2 Tflops. We find about the same 1.6x improvement if we use PS4 (1080p 30fps) as a baseline.

It runs extremely well on my RTX3060ti at max settings, 1440p, 4x MSAA. haven't dropped below 60 yet and often hang around 80fps with occasional dips to the mid 60s and spikes to the high 90s or even slightly above 100fps when nothing is around
CPU should not be an issue either, my Ryzen 5600X is at around 34% CPU usage during a race.

I am literally at 100+fps whenever I am modifying my car (during which Raytracing is active)... that is surprising given how extremely high quality they made it.
the reflections have at least 2 bounces, maybe even 3... you can see the reflection of the side mirror in the window of the car, and on that reflection of the side mirror you will see the reflection of the room, all at full resolution and zero ghosting.
